Interview at UCONN tomorrow...ANY ADVICE for those who interviewed there...things to bring up about the school?
 
Uconn is an easy interview, but a long day. by the time I got to the pbl session at the end of the day, I was a bit exhausted-- they didn't feed us lunch until 2, so make sure you get a good breakfast before you arrive.
Otherwise, the only thing I found was that they seemed to focus a lot on the strength of the dental program during the tour, and that concerned me a bit, because it seems to me they should have focused more on the med school. that being said, it was a student tour guide, and who knows how much training they get.
The students are great-- everyone is so friendly. The get to know you session can be a bit stressful (all the interviewees and the dean of the school) but the rest of it is really laid back.
